About Why Do Lights Go Out Randomly?
Lights that cut out and come back are most commonly caused by loose loop connections at ceiling roses, failing LED downlight drivers, or corroded terminations in aged switchboards. These faults arc and heat with every cycle — an arcing connection inside a wall or ceiling cavity can ignite without warning, so call 0433 462 902 or book a diagnostic now.
Sydney homes built before 2000 carry the highest exposure to aged switchboard terminations; homes retrofitted with LED downlights are prone to driver failures that look identical from the floor. What to Do Right Now in Castle Hill
- Note the pattern. Time of day, duration of dropout, what else was running.
- Identify the scope. One light, one room, one circuit, or a wider area.
- Try a different bulb in the affected fitting. If it dropouts identically, the fault is upstream.
- Check for thermal correlation. Does it always happen after the lights have been on for a while?
- Check for load correlation. Does it always happen when an oven, kettle, AC, or pool pump cycles?
- Smell-check switches and fittings during a dropout if safe.
- Listen for buzzing or clicking from the switchboard or affected switches.
- Touch-test switches and fittings — none should be hot.
- Photograph any visible damage for our diagnostic dispatch.
Electrical work in Castle Hill
Castle Hill's housing is a real mix, and each era throws up its own electrical jobs. Plenty of the established streets are full of brick-veneer and full-brick homes from the 1960s through the 1980s on big Hills District blocks, and a lot of those still run undersized switchboards with ceramic fuses or early circuit breakers and no proper RCD protection. Bringing those boards up to current standards with safety switches, and checking tired wiring on long cable runs, is bread-and-butter work out here. Endeavour Energy is the local network distributor, so any service-mains, point-of-attachment or metering work needs an accredited Level 2 ASP.
The other side of Castle Hill is the knock-down-rebuild and large two-storey homes, plus the high-rise and medium-density strata that's gone up around the Metro stations. Big modern homes with ducted air, pools, induction cooking and EV charging often need a three-phase upgrade and a heavier consumer mains. New builds and strata blocks mean fresh network connections, main switchboard work and metering coordination, all squarely Level 2 territory.
